Aquanaut Scuba, a family-run PADI 5* Instructor Development Centre with over 20 years of excellence, is seeking a passionate and motivated Centre Assistant to join our dynamic team. This exciting role spans our Kingston and West Norwood retail stores, our training pool, and service centre, offering a unique opportunity to work in a vibrant, fast-paced environment at the heart of the scuba and snorkelling community.
What You’ll Do:
- Customer Engagement: Assist customers with retail sales of scuba and snorkelling equipment, process bookings for PADI training courses and equipment servicing, and handle in-store air fills (with the opportunity to train in gas blending).
- Retail Operations: Manage stock, maintain shop presentation, and ensure a welcoming environment for our diverse clientele.
- Training Support: Organise training evenings and weekends, including preparing dive kits, completing paperwork, and coordinating logistics.
- Optional Teaching Role: For candidates who are in-status PADI Instructors with a valid HSE medical, there’s the chance to deliver PADI courses and inspire the next generation of divers.
What We’re Looking For:
- Enthusiasm for scuba diving, snorkelling, and marine conservation, with a customer-focused mindset.
- Strong organisational and communication skills to thrive in a busy retail and training environment.
- Flexibility to work across our Kingston, Tolworth and West Norwood locations, with hours tailored to suit business needs.
- Preferred: A valid driver’s license and age 25+ to operate our company van (not essential).
- Bonus: PADI Instructor status with HSE medical for teaching opportunities (not required).
What We Offer:
- Comprehensive Training: Full training on our shop systems, compressor operations, and gas blending, with no prior experience required.
- Career Development: Opportunities for further PADI training and professional growth under the guidance of our in-house Course Director.
- Community and Culture: Join a tight-knit, passionate team dedicated to delivering exceptional experiences and promoting marine conservation.
- Flexible Hours: Work across our two stores, swimming pool and service centre with a schedule designed to balance your lifestyle.
